How much does it cost to rent a home in Somerset Professional Park?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Somerset Professional Park 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,722 | $1,150 | $2,750 |
| Somerset Professional Park 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,313 | $1,890 | $2,800 |
| Somerset Professional Park 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,675 | $1,950 | $3,400 |
| Somerset Professional Park 6 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,000 | $2,000 | $2,000 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Somerset Professional Park
What type of rentals are currently available in Somerset Professional Park?
There are currently 198 Apartments for Rent in Somerset Professional Park, FL with pricing that ranges from $509 to $4,095. There are also 58 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Somerset Professional Park ranging from $790 to $3,400.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Somerset Professional Park?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Somerset Professional Park ranges from $790 to $3,400 with an average monthly rent of $1,846.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Somerset Professional Park?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Somerset Professional Park range from $639 to $3,729,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,890 to $2,800.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$1,950 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$509.
